#breadcrumb a:hover, #breadcrumb a:active,
.block h1, .block h1 :link, .block h2, .block h2 :link,
.block h3, .block h3 :link, .block strong, .block a:active, .block a:hover {
  color: #01a262;
}
.block h1 :visited, .block h2 :visited, .block h3 :visited { color: #7eab99; }
#subnav li a:hover, #subnav li a:active, #subnav li.expanded a {
  background: #d9f1e8;
}
#subnav li a.active, #subnav li li a:hover, #subnav li li a:active {
  background: #98d9c0;
}

#masthead .switcher a { color: #01a262; }
#columns td.wide :link { color: #01a262; }
#columns td.wide :visited { color: #7eab99; }
#columns td.wide table.properties tbody { background: #b9e5d4; }
#columns td.wide table.properties th { background: #57c298; }
#columns td.wide .category .block .inline-categories li a {
  background-image: url(icon/sports/products.gif);
}
#columns td.wide .category .block .inline-products li a {
  background-image: url(icon/sports/details.gif);
}
#columns td.wide .searchresults .details a {
  background-image: url(icon/sports/products.gif); color: #01a262;
}
#columns td.wide .category .block .details a,
#columns td.wide .related .block .details a,
#columns td.wide .searchresults .product .details a {
  background-image: url(icon/sports/details.gif); color: #01a262;
}
#columns td.wide .product .block .downloads a {
  background-image: url(icon/sports/download.gif);
}

#columns td.wide .product .block .links a.filetype0 {
  background-image: url(icon/sports/link.gif);
}
#columns td.wide .product .block .links a.filetype1 {
  background-image: url(icon/sports/document.gif);
}
#columns td.wide .product .block .links a.filetype2 {
  background-image: url(icon/sports/movie.gif);
}

#columns td.wide .product .block a .zoom {
  background-image: url(icon/sports/zoom.gif); color: #01a262;
}
#col0 .blockwrap, td.teaser .blockwrap { background-image: url(blockspl.gif);
  border-color: #01a262;
}
#col0 .block, td.teaser .block { background-image: url(blockspr.gif); }
#columns td.teaser .block img.content { border-bottom-color: #01a262; }

.block li.section { border-color: #b9e5d4; }

p.user-message { background-image: url(icon/sports/info.gif); }

/* Assembly Instructions*/
a.filetype0 { background-image: url(icon/sports/link.gif); background-repeat: no-repeat; padding-left: 20px;}
a.filetype1 { background-image: url(icon/sports/document.gif); background-repeat: no-repeat; padding-left: 20px;}
a.filetype2 { background-image: url(icon/sports/movie.gif); background-repeat: no-repeat; padding-left: 20px;}

.instructions h1 { background-image: url(icon/sports/instruction.gif);}
tr .row1 { background-color:#D9F1E8; }

.instruction_pages { background-image: url(icon/sports/instruction_new.gif); 
                     border-bottom: 1px solid #01A262; 
                     border-top: 1px solid #01A262;}

